Dr. Dagobert David Runes was the founder of The Philosophical Library, a spiritual organization and publisher. After receiving his Doctorate in Philosophy from the University of Vienna in 1924, he emigrated to the United States, where he became editor of The Modern Thinker and later Current Digest. From 1931 to 1934 he was Director of the Institute for Advanced Education in New York City.
